Understanding Autonomous Robotics Guitar Effects Pedals: Autonomous robotics guitar effects pedals combine the elements of robotic technology and signal processing to create a dynamic and interactive effects pedal experience. Traditional guitar effects pedals are pedalboards that allow guitarists to modify their instrument's signal, adding effects like distortion, reverb, delay, and more. The autonomous robotics aspect introduces real-time modulation, artificial intelligence, and self-learning algorithms, adding a new layer of complexity and responsiveness to the sound manipulation process. 2. How They Work: Autonomous robotics guitar effects pedals employ a combination of sensors, actuators, and AI algorithms to analyze the incoming audio signal and generate real-time changes. These pedals can detect the guitar player's style, speed, and even emotional nuances, adapting the effects accordingly. They can create responsive effects that interact with the musician's playing, mimicking their style or taking it to new and unexpected dimensions. Additionally, these pedals often come with user-friendly interfaces, allowing artists to program custom settings and fine-tune their desired sound. 3.
